Shock Hooks That Demand Full Watches
Nothing hijacks attention like a taboo confession. The 'Kissed a random stranger' opener thrives because it triggers voyeuristic intrigue—viewers' brains light up with 'what happened next?' dopamine hits. Keep it ultra-short (under 5 seconds), film in vibrant public spots for authenticity, and enable infinite loops. Psychologically, this exploits the Zeigarnik effect: unfinished stories compel replays. For dating apps, tease it as 'What my app match led to...' to bridge organic virality with conversions.
Twist Endings for Maximum Relatability
Repurposing trends like 'How many months have you been together?' with a punchy 'we just met' reveal flips expectations, creating joyful surprise. Use consistent slide progressions—build suspense over 3-4 frames—ending with your narrative pivot. This works because it mirrors real dating unpredictability, resonating with singles' hopes. On Instagram Reels, extend to 15 seconds with subtle app overlays; TikTok favors the snappier version. Engagement spikes from comment sections filled with 'This is me!' stories.
Bullet-List Dramas Paired with Epic Visuals
From a male POV, rapid-fire bullet recaps of romance sagas (e.g., meet-cute to mishap) overlaid on wedding or proposal stock footage deliver bite-sized epics. The format's power lies in its scannability—viewers consume drama like a gossip thread. It humanizes dating fails/wins, fostering empathy. Adapt by anonymizing bullets with app-generated chats, turning passive watches into 'I need this app' moments. Repeated appearances signal trend endurance; test variations like 'She said yes after...' hooks.
Mystery Questions Fueling AI-Driven Buzz
Hooks like 'Am I cooked?'—slang for 'ruined'—hint at juicy drama without spoilers, perfect for AI creators blending humor and relatability. Follow with chat reveals for easy brand inserts. This leverages curiosity gaps and Gen Z lingo, boosting comments like 'Spill the tea!' Platforms reward duets/reactions, amplifying reach. For dating apps, use it for red-flag analyses: 'Am I cooked swiping on this app?' Watch completion soar as viewers self-insert.
Trendjacking with a Product Twist
Even 'cringe' trends like 'Vogue having a boyfriend' persist by offering easy, lip-sync fun. Pair exaggerated romance boasts with app plugs for quick wins, despite saturation. Its edge? Low production barrier—dance, overlay text like 'Find yours on [App]'. Timing is key: jump in early, exit before fatigue. Psychologically, aspirational vibes counter dating app cynicism, driving downloads via FOMO.
Adaptation Blueprint for Your Campaigns
To weaponize these: 1) A/B test hooks in first 3 seconds. 2) Layer CTAs subtly (e.g., 'Link in bio for your story'). 3) Cross-post TikTok to IG with taller aspect ratios. 4) Monitor duets for user-generated traction. 5) Refresh weekly to dodge algorithm staleness.
